Half the steps to test - with the new and only, all-in-one blood glucose monitoring system

Roche Diagnostics, a pioneer in monitoring solutions for people with diabetes, is launching a new and unique, ergonomically designed blood glucose monitoring system - that looks like a mobile phone - combining all the necessary measurement tools in one instrument. The only one of its kind, the new Accu-Chek Compact Plus is a three-in-one solution comprising of a detachable lancing device, a test strip drum with 17 test strips and a meter with a bright self-illuminating display.

Now users can measure their blood glucose levels in half the steps as the new Compact Plus has a drum with 17 built-in test strips which eliminates strip handlingi . One push of the button and the strip appears, ready to use, making the process simple, fast and hygenic.

Also, the user need not worry about coding as Accu-Chek Compact Plus automatically self-codes to ensure accuracy of testing. The quick five second test reading is complemented with an easy to read, glow-in-the dark display.

A further advantage is that the user needs only one hand to operate the measurement functions as the device has a detachable finger pricker, the Accu-Chek Softclix Plus, with a patented design. Furthermore, the 11-depth settings allow for virtually pain-free blood sampling from 0.8mm to 2.3mm.

Accu-Chek Compact Plus is available through pharmaciesii, diabetes clinics or direct from Roche from November 2007, replacing the current model as stocks on shelf sell out. About Roche and the Roche Diagnostics Division
Headquartered in Basel, Switzerland, Roche is one of the world's leading research-focused healthcare groups in the fields of pharmaceuticals and diagnostics. As a supplier of innovative products and services for the early detection, prevention, diagnosis and treatment of diseases, the Group contributes on a broad range of fronts to improving people's health and quality of life. Roche is a world leader in diagnostics, the leading supplier of drugs for cancer and transplantation and a market leader in virology. In 2006 sales by the Pharmaceuticals Division totalled 33.3 billion Swiss francs, and the Diagnostics Division posted sales of 8.7 billion Swiss francs. Roche employs roughly 75,000 people in 150 countries and has R&D agreements and strategic alliances with numerous partners, including majority ownership interests in Genentech and Chugai Roche's Diagnostics Division offers a uniquely broad product portfolio and supplies a wide array of innovative testing products and services to researchers, physicians, patients, hospitals and laboratories world-wide.
